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3383625 92823476 889187 383
39613861 2232147424 94707859
39613861 2232147424 94707859
0723308 0120 8170979
All about undefined
Interested in learning more?
39613861 2232147424 94707859
0723308 0120 8170979
See more
765167 903
70145 1566 344300058 5630
See more
30 89658 5888662
764 405017799 207471 1380
See more